Cycloidal gear reducers, unlike traditional gear mechanisms, offer a unique approach to power transmission. They utilize a cycloidal disc and a set of pins to achieve motion, which results in several advantages over conventional gear types such as helical gearboxes and planetary gearboxes. The cycloidal design is renowned for its compact size, high reduction ratios, and exceptional torque capability, making it an ideal choice for industries looking to optimize their machinery setup.

In comparison to helical gearboxes and planetary gear reducers, cycloidal gear reducers offer a more robust and reliable solution for industries dealing with high vibration and shock loads. The inherent design of cycloidal gears allows them to absorb and dissipate these forces more effectively, ensuring smoother operation and reducing the risk of mechanical failure. This is a critical advantage in sectors such as mining, construction, and heavy manufacturing, where machinery is subjected to extreme conditions.
